George Hicks, the Smallest Cabin in the Klondike, c1898 Routes to the Klondike; Animals Power Dam 12 Mile CreekSelf portrait of George Hicks sitting in front of "the smallest cabin in the Klondike." The cabin is made of logs with moss covering walls, held in place by vertical poles. The window is made from bottles held in place by small vertical poles. The roof is sod, and the walls are banked with dirt. The door is made of vertical poles as well. Appears to be Gold Hill in the background.
